Lab-grown opals are real opals. They possess the same chemical composition (hydrated silica, SiO₂·nH₂O), internal structure, and optical phenomenon of play-of-colour as natural precious opal. The only difference is their origin.

A REAL OPAL. CREATED THROUGH SCIENCE.

This gem was produced using advanced laboratory methods that carefully replicate the microscopic silica sphere structure responsible for precious opal's remarkable optical effects. Manufactured within one of the world's leading high-technology gem-growing laboratories, these opals exhibit exceptional colour stability, consistency, and outstanding visual performance.

The resulting material is genuine precious opal—not glass, resin, or an imitation—and displays authentic play-of-colour created by the diffraction of light through its highly ordered internal structure.

With a Mohs hardness of approximately 5.5–6.5, opal is best suited to jewellery that receives moderate wear. Its remarkable optical beauty makes it one of the world's most distinctive and fascinating gem materials.
